
1.docker单节点安装
docker run --name mongodb -m 1024M --restart=always -v /home/dev/mongodb/datadir:/data/db -p 27017:27017 -e MONGO_INITDB_ROOT_USERNAME=admin -e MONGO_INITDB_ROOT_PASSWORD=123456 -d mongo:4.4.11-rc1-focal
2.客户端连接说明
#连接本地数据库服务器,端口是默认的 mongodb://localhost #使用用户名fred,密码foobar登录localhost的admin数据库。 mongodb://fred:foobar@localhost #使用用户名fred,密码foobar登录localhost的baz数据库。 mongodb://fred:foobar@localhost/baz #连接 replica pair, 服务器1为example1.com服务器2为example2。 mongodb://example1.com:27017,example2.com:27017 #连接 replica set 三台服务器 (端口 27017, 27018, 和27019): mongodb://localhost,localhost:27018,localhost:27019 #连接 replica set 三台服务器, 写入 *** 作应用在主服务器 并且分布查询到从服务器。 mongodb://host1,host2,host3/?slaveOk=true #直接连接第一个服务器,无论是replica set一部分或者主服务器或者从服务器。 mongodb://host1,host2,host3/?connect=direct;slaveOk=true #当你的连接服务器有优先级,还需要列出所有服务器,你可以使用上述连接方式。安全模式连接到localhost: mongodb://localhost/?safe=true #以安全模式连接到replica set,并且等待至少两个复制服务器成功写入,超时时间设置为2秒。 mongodb://host1,host2,host3/?safe=true;w=2;wtimeoutMS=2000
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)